Chapter 142 Three Zhaos
The last few pages of the journal were written with the name "Zhao". The handwriting on those pages was much neater than the previous ones—as if it was written stroke by stroke so that future readers wouldn't be able to read it.
"I must write these three 'Zhao's' clearly," the master wrote. "Otherwise, later generations won't understand and will mistake good people for enemies. In ancient times, there was a pure Yin lineage surnamed Zhao. This lineage and the peak Yang of my Nirvana Mountain shared the same object and kept the same covenant. This is the main branch. In ancient times, a group of people came from this lineage. They refused to keep the covenant; they wanted to take it."
"They said: Since that thing is the source of death and possesses immense power, why suppress it? Why not use it?"
"This group broke the covenant, fell into depravity, and became a collateral branch."
"For two thousand years, they have only done one thing—to release the 'Abyss' from underground and use it for their own purposes."
"The one sitting over there now calls himself 'Lord of the Abyss.' He is the current leader of this branch."
Ye Feng's eyes narrowed.
"So, boss," Shen Yu gasped, "you and Miss Lin are from the same lineage?"
"They are two ends of the same vein," Ye Feng said. "One end guards, the other seizes. Twenty years ago, only she and her daughter remained on the guarding end. On the seizing end, the line has never been broken for two thousand years."
Lin Yuqing's face turned ashen. Her fingertips landed on those three words—"The Zhao Family Lineage".
"I always thought," her voice was soft, "that my mother was just an ordinary woman who married into the Lin family. The story I heard growing up was that her family had long since disappeared, and she came to Dongyang to seek refuge with relatives. Turns out, 'long since disappeared' meant—"
She couldn't continue. Ye Feng picked up where she left off.
"They were all wiped out."
Lin Yuqing sat down on the old wooden stool next to her. She sat there for a long time before speaking.
When I was little, I asked my dad once why no one was home at my maternal grandmother's house.
"My dad said that your mom's side of the family suffered a disaster."
"I was eight years old at the time, and I thought 'disaster' meant earthquakes or floods."
She covered her face with her hands.
"Ye Feng".
"I am here."
"For the past twenty-six years, I've always considered myself a pretty capable person." Her voice was muffled in her palms. "I took over the company, led the board of directors, and won so many battles. I thought I earned my life myself. But it turns out I didn't."
"My life was bought with my own blood. The year she died, she brought all those who followed this lineage upon herself."
"She risked her life to hide me in the shell of 'the Lin family's daughter,' and kept me hidden for twenty years."
Ye Feng squatted down to be at eye level with her.
"Are you finished speaking?"
Lin Yuqing was taken aback.
"I'm done." She lowered her hand, her eyes red.
"Then I'll tell you," Ye Feng looked at her, "It's true that your mother hid you for twenty years. But when you took over that mess at twenty-three, she was already gone. Those seven people on the board who wanted to devour you, you outlasted them one by one. The accounts on the thirty-ninth floor, you led the guards yourself. Those are yours. Nobody can take them away."
There is a third paragraph in the journal.
"There's a third Zhao."
"Among the four major families of Dongyang, there is the Zhao family."
"This family is a distant branch of that fallen lineage scattered among the people. Their bloodline is so thin that it is almost nonexistent, and they themselves do not even know who they are."
"But bloodlines, being thin, doesn't mean they're nonexistent."
"In this family, every few generations there is always someone who has an almost insane obsession with 'pure yin'—they can't move at the slightest hint of it, and spend their whole lives thinking about getting that 'key', as if that would make up for what's missing in them."
"I've met people like that over the years."
"They are pitiful, but they harm people."
Ye Feng suddenly remembered that night at Baicao Mountain. He remembered Zhao Hui's face contorted in pain after he struck a nerve with Zhao Hui's words; he remembered Zhao Hui's subconscious action of clutching his briefcase to protect his heart.
"Zhao Hui," he said softly.
"What?" Shen Yu was taken aback.
"I took his pulse at Baicao Mountain." Ye Feng closed the notebook. "He had a wisp of pure yin energy, so thin it was almost imperceptible. He wasn't working for his employer. He wanted to snatch this 'key' from his employer and take it for himself."
The room fell silent for a few moments.
"This person is more difficult to deal with than the boss," Lin Yuqing said.
Ye Feng looked at her.
"The boss wants her for a big deal." She spoke slowly, as if analyzing a merger and acquisition at a board meeting. "Big deals involve costs, trade-offs, and negotiation. But Zhao Hui isn't like that. What Zhao Hui wants is something he himself lacks. That kind of person is willing to risk everything."
Ye Feng nodded. In the past six months of dealing with Zhao Hui, what he feared most was never the man's cunning, but rather the way he looked at Lin Yuqing.
"Is there anything else at the end of the notes?" Shen Yu asked.
Ye Feng reopened the booklet and flipped to the last page. On the last page were only three short lines. The ink was new—much newer than the previous ones.
"In the spring of the year Bingwu, the neighbor went up the mountain."
"I handed over the sect to the next generation, and entrusted my life to that one thing."
"I can't die here. If I die, that thing will belong to them."
"I'll take it with me."
"Go as far as you can."
"Feng'er, if you see this page—"
"Don't come looking for me."
"Go to Heqi Cliff."
Ye Feng stared at the last four words for a long time without moving. Shen Yu murmured beside him, "Master is... using himself as bait."
"It's not bait." Ye Feng shook his head.
"What is that?"
"He took the most dangerous thing, tied it to himself, and led the people of the mountain away."
Ye Feng slowly clenched the booklet in his hand.
He knew his employer would definitely pursue him.
"He also knew that as long as he was alive and still running around with that thing, the master wouldn't have time to focus all his efforts on her."
He raised his head: "For the past six months, I've always thought Master had disappeared. Actually, for the past six months, he's been covering for us."
Outside the window, darkness fell. The branches of the old jujube tree rustled against the window paper in the wind. Lin Yuqing walked to Ye Feng's side and placed her hand on the back of his hand, which was clutching the booklet.
"Ye Feng".
"Um."
"Your master did two things in his life."
Which two items?
"One is that he carried me in his arms twenty-six years ago," she said softly. "The other is that he carried you back from the mass grave more than six years ago. No one knew about these two things when he did them. He carried it all by himself for more than twenty years."
She gripped his hand tighter.
"Let's go to Heqi Cliff."
"Let's get that half back."
"Then we went to find him."
